PROBLEM TO BE SOLVED: To enable the restoration of hydrophilicity and antifogging property by subjecting the rear surface of glass having a specific or lower Sn concentration of the glass surface to reflective coating, thereby applying a simple cleaning treatment thereto. SOLUTION: A mirror 1 formed by subjecting the rear surface of the glass 1 of <=2% in the Sn concentration on the glass 1 surface to the reflective coating is used. As a result, even if the contact angle of the mirror 1 surface with water rises to >=20 deg. and the stainproof and antifogging properties are lost, the hydrophilicitiy may be restored to a high level by subjecting the surface of the mirror 1 to a cleaning treatment with a surfactant. Stains are hardly stickable and the maintenance of the hydrophilicity for a long period of time may be expected. Water washing, detergent cleaning, ultrasonic cleaning, etc., may be effectively used as the washing treatment of the mirror 1 surface although these treatments depend upon the degree of staining. The restoration of not only the appearance but the hydrophilicility of the high degree as well is possible after the cleaning treatment and, therefore, the antifogging, surface cleaning, antistatic and other effects are again exhibited.
